I recently bought an HP laptop with Vista Home Premium. I have an HP desktop running XP(sp2) and have a new HP C4280 printer attached to the desktop with USB. It works fine. I installed this printer on my new laptop, also with a USB connection so I could install the software. I am on high speed DSL connection with a wireless Westell VersaLink router/modem. I have selected the printer as default and shared on the desktop and have selected default on the laptop. When I try to print it gives me a port error(USB) I don't know how to change the settings so I can print wirelessly from my laptop

First of all, you must verify that both computers are in the same workgroup and both are connected to the router. I assume that you have already enabled file and printer sharing on the desktop. Then on your laptop, do an add printer, select network printer. Assuming the printer share name is HPC4280, type \\host computer name\HPC4280. Since you already installed the printer driver on your laptop, it should be detected.

Thanks for your reply..I have the printer shared and went to laptop and added a network printer...I made sure the address syntax showed my desktop name and then printer name..it show sending a document to the printer, but it doesn't print or connect...I even tried to add a tcp/ip port named the same syntax and still nothing.

I have a desktop running XP-SP2 with a USB printer. I recently bought a new laptop running Vista Home Premium. I am using a Bellsouth dsl wireless network...I want to be able to print wirelessly from my laptop. I installed the printer with USB to get the drivers on laptop. I then created a new local port for the printer and gave the location as "\desktop name\printer name"...when I try to print it does not give an error message and does not even show up in the print queue. I contact HP support and they supplied me with a file download for XP they said I needed. They then said the problem was in my network. I can ping my laptop after disabling Norton, but cannot ping my desktop. Bellsouth says I have another security program blocking..I went to msconfig and viewed my start programs and see nothing else..I had previously diisabled spysweeper.
What is your opinion??
